Handover: Validator Plugin System (Marrowline)

Welcome aboard. The plugin registry loads data validators from the `plugins/` directory at startup; signing keys for third-party plugins live in the sealed keystore. You'll need to unlock it once to register your local dev plugin. The keystore accepts the recovery passphrase noted below.

vault phrase of tawig-taduf = zorath-oliwyn

Service account: guidecast-sync. This account lets the Murrowfield audio-guide app pull exhibit narration updates from the internal content service each night. If syncs fail, check the account's scope before restarting the worker; a stale scope is the usual cause. Restarts are safe and idempotent. During an incident, authenticate manually against the content service using the key below.

service key, fawip-bajef: kto11_Qt5wZK9vdNC

Quarterly Planning Note — Logistics Provider Change

For sales leads. We are moving fulfilment from Harrowden Freight to Veltway Logistics at quarter start. Expect a two-week cutover with longer lead times on the Orrin line. Quote standard delivery windows plus three days until further notice. The reasoning behind the switch appears in the note below.

board note of bawep-tajef: Queniusek Systems plans to raise the Quenvan list price by 53.1 percent in March. The pricing group signed off on a budget of $176.4 million for Project Drueth. The renewal with Casionix Partners closes at $142.5 million a year, 8.3 percent below the last contract. Project Fraax slips by six weeks because of the tooling delay.